在数字化浪潮的推动下,网站作为企业与用户交互的核心载体,其处理效率与响应速度直接影响着用户体验与商业价值。随着用户对即时反馈的需求日益增强,如何通过技术手段与策略优化实现网站性能的飞跃,成为开发者与运维团队面临的重要课题。
前端性能优化
前端代码的加载与执行效率是网站响应速度的关键。通过压缩CSS、JavaScript文件并合并冗余代码,可减少HTTP请求次数与资源体积。例如,利用Webpack等构建工具进行Tree Shaking,可删除未引用的代码模块,使文件体积平均缩减30%以上。Vite等新兴工具通过ES模块原生支持,可将开发环境的热更新速度提升至毫秒级,大幅缩短调试周期。
浏览器渲染机制优化同样不可忽视。采用Virtual DOM技术(如React、Vue框架)可减少直接操作DOM带来的性能损耗,数据显示,复杂页面的渲染效率可提升40%。对于长列表场景,虚拟滚动技术仅渲染可视区域元素,将万级数据列表的内存占用从数百MB降至数十MB。通过Web Workers将计算密集型任务转移至后台线程,可避免主线程阻塞,保持界面流畅。
服务端架构革新
微服务架构通过业务解耦实现效率突破。将单体应用拆分为独立部署的微服务模块,不仅降低系统耦合度,更支持弹性扩缩容。某电商平台案例显示,采用Spring Cloud微服务体系后,订单模块的并发处理能力从每秒500次提升至2000次,且故障隔离机制使系统可用性达到99.99%。配合Kubernetes进行容器编排,可实现服务实例的自动化部署与负载均衡。
异步处理机制显著提升吞吐量。通过消息队列(如RabbitMQ、Kafka)将耗时操作异步化,支付系统的交易响应时间从2秒缩短至200毫秒。结合Redis等内存数据库缓存热点数据,某社交平台的用户信息查询延迟从50ms降至3ms。数据库层面,分库分表策略与读写分离架构,使千万级数据表的查询效率提升8倍以上。
智能缓存策略设计
浏览器缓存机制的合理配置可减少重复请求。设置强缓存(Cache-Control: max-age=31536000)使静态资源有效期长达一年,配合内容哈希实现资源更新自动失效。某新闻门户实践表明,合理配置缓存策略后,重复访问的页面加载时间减少70%。Service Worker技术的离线缓存能力,更让PWA应用在弱网环境仍可流畅运行。
服务端缓存体系需要分层构建。Nginx反向代理层通过proxy_cache模块实现边缘节点缓存,某视频网站实测数据显示,CDN节点命中率超95%。分布式缓存集群(如Memcached、Redis Cluster)可将数据库查询压力降低80%,某金融系统通过多级缓存架构,将核心接口的QPS从1000提升至20000。
基础设施升级路径
服务器硬件选型直接影响计算效率。采用NVMe固态硬盘替代机械硬盘,数据库IOPS性能提升50倍。某游戏平台使用GPU加速图像处理,渲染帧率从30FPS跃升至120FPS。在云原生环境中,弹性裸金属服务器提供物理机级别的性能,某AI训练平台使用后,模型训练时间缩短40%。
网络传输优化需多管齐下。HTTP/3协议基于QUIC实现0-RTT握手,某即时通讯应用接入后,消息传输延迟降低30%。智能路由算法动态选择最优网络路径,跨国企业的全球服务响应差异从±500ms压缩至±50ms。通过TLS 1.3协议精简握手流程,HTTPS连接建立时间减少至1个RTT,安全性反而提升。
全链路监控体系
实时监控系统需覆盖全技术栈。APM工具(如SkyWalking、Pinpoint)实现代码级性能追踪,某电商系统通过热点方法分析,定位到导致GC频繁的代码段,优化后系统停顿时间减少80%。日志分析平台(如ELK Stack)处理日均TB级日志数据,异常检测准确率达99%。结合AI算法进行异常预测,某银行系统实现故障提前30分钟预警。
插件下载说明
未提供下载提取码的插件,都是站长辛苦开发!需要的请联系本站客服或者站长!
织梦二次开发QQ群
本站客服QQ号:862782808(点击左边QQ号交流),群号(383578617) 如果您有任何织梦问题,请把问题发到群里,阁主将为您写解决教程!
转载请注明: 织梦模板 » 网站建设过程中如何提升处理效率与响应速度